Clean up some stuff and make a hello world app to deploy

This commit is contained in:
Aaron Mueller 2013-09-28 11:35:23 +02:00
parent 56c3e433e9
commit 203892a0ca
12 changed files with 28 additions and 146 deletions

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long

View file

@ -1,47 +1,4 @@
html, * {
body { margin: 0;
font-family: 'Helvetica Neue', Helvetica, Arial, sans-serif; padding: 0;
height: 100%;
} }
.error {
color: red;
}
/*footer based on http://twitter.github.com/bootstrap/examples/sticky-footer-navbar.html */
/* Wrapper for page content to push down footer */
#wrap {
min-height: 100%;
height: auto !important;
height: 100%;
/* Negative indent footer by it's height */
margin: 0 auto -60px;
}
/* Set the fixed height of the footer here */
#push,
#footer {
height: 60px;
}
#footer {
background-color: #f5f5f5;
}
/* Lastly, apply responsive CSS fixes as necessary */
@media (max-width: 767px) {
#footer {
margin-left: -20px;
margin-right: -20px;
padding-left: 20px;
padding-right: 20px;
}
}
#wrap > .container,
#wrap > .container-fluid{
padding-top: 60px;
}
.container .footer-text {
margin: 20px 0;
}

File diff suppressed because one or more lines are too long

View file

@ -0,0 +1,2 @@
$(function() {
});

View file

@ -1,11 +0,0 @@
### Here are some links to get started
1. [HTML templating](http://www.luminusweb.net/docs/html_templating.md)
2. [Accessing the database](http://www.luminusweb.net/docs/database.md)
3. [Serving static resources](http://www.luminusweb.net/docs/static_resources.md)
4. [Setting response types](http://www.luminusweb.net/docs/responses.md)
5. [Defining routes](http://www.luminusweb.net/docs/routes.md)
6. [Adding middleware](http://www.luminusweb.net/docs/middleware.md)
7. [Sessions and cookies](http://www.luminusweb.net/docs/sessions_cookies.md)
8. [Security](http://www.luminusweb.net/docs/security.md)
9. [Deploying the application](http://www.luminusweb.net/docs/deployment.md)

View file

@ -3,13 +3,13 @@
(:require [ldview.views.layout :as layout] (:require [ldview.views.layout :as layout]
[ldview.util :as util])) [ldview.util :as util]))
; Just for now ...
(defn waiting-page []
(layout/render "waiting.html"))
(defn home-page [] (defn home-page []
(layout/render (layout/render
"home.html" {:content (util/md->html "/md/docs.md")})) "home.html" {:content (util/md->html "/md/docs.md")}))
(defn about-page []
(layout/render "about.html"))
(defroutes home-routes (defroutes home-routes
(GET "/" [] (home-page)) (GET "/" [] (waiting-page)))
(GET "/about" [] (about-page)))

View file

@ -1,38 +1,21 @@
<!DOCTYPE html PUBLIC ""> <!DOCTYPE html PUBLIC "">
<html> <html>
<head> <head>
<META http-equiv="Content-Type" content="text/html; charset=UTF-8"> <META http-equiv="Content-Type" content="text/html; charset=UTF-8">
<title>Welcome to ldview</title> <title>ldview -- an alternative Ludum Dare entry viewer</title>
<link href="{{servlet-context}}/css/bootstrap.min.css" rel="stylesheet" type="text/css"> <link href="{{servlet-context}}/css/screen.css" rel="stylesheet" type="text/css">
<link href="{{servlet-context}}/css/bootstrap-responsive.min.css" rel="stylesheet" type="text/css"> <script type="text/javascript">var context = "{{servlet-context}}";</script>
<link href="{{servlet-context}}/css/screen.css" rel="stylesheet" type="text/css"> <script src="//code.jquery.com/jquery-1.10.1.min.js" type="text/javascript"></script>
<script type="text/javascript"> var context = "{{servlet-context}}"; </script><script src="//code.jquery.com/jquery-1.10.1.min.js" type="text/javascript"></script><script src="{{servlet-context}}/js/bootstrap.min.js" type="text/javascript"></script> <script src="{{servlet-context}}/js/content-browser.js" type="text/javascript"></script>
</head> </head>
<body> <body>
<div id="wrap">
<div class="navbar navbar-fixed-top navbar-inverse">
<div class="navbar-inner">
<ul class="nav">
<li>
<a href="{{servlet-context}}/">Home</a>
</li>
<li>
<a href="{{servlet-context}}/about">About</a>
</li>
</ul>
</div>
</div>
<div class="container">
{% block content %}
{% endblock %} <a href="{{servlet-context}}/">Home</a>
</div>
<div id="push"></div> <div class="container">
</div> {% block content %}
<div id="footer"> {% endblock %}
<div class="container"> </div>
<p class="muted footer-text">Footer content.</p>
</div> </body>
</div>
</body>
</html> </html>

View file

@ -1,23 +1,4 @@
{% extends "ldview/views/templates/base.html" %} {% extends "ldview/views/templates/base.html" %}
{% block content %} {% block content %}
<div class="hero-unit">
<h1>Welcome to ldview</h1>
<p>Time to start building your site!</p>
<p><a class="btn btn-primary btn-large" href="http://luminusweb.net">Learn more &raquo;</a></p>
</div>
<div class="row-fluid">
<div class="span8">
{{content|safe}} {{content|safe}}
</div>
</div>
{% endblock %} {% endblock %}

View file

@ -1,10 +1,4 @@
{% extends "ldview/views/templates/base.html" %} {% extends "ldview/views/templates/base.html" %}
{% block content %} {% block content %}
<p>Smething big is comming soon ...</p>
<p>this is the story of ldview... work in progress</p>
{% endblock %} {% endblock %}